Caribbean Music Evolution: What's Next for The Sound?

The trajectory of Caribbean sounds has been a fascinating one, and it is no stranger. From its beginnings in the Eighties Jamaica, this genre has expanded globally, incorporating influences from various musical styles. Now, as internet platforms alter the industry, what's next for the vibe? We’re observing a combination of lines with African rhythms , Latin urban music, and even touches of electronic production, suggesting a progression that’s dynamic and potentially unpredictable .
